Sony, The Next Apple?

It seems that the head honchos over at Sony have decided to ramp things up a notch in their smartphone business.

This article via The Telegraph details Sony's plans to focus only on "high-end mobile devices." Sound familiar? Basically the company wants to see the same profit margins as Apple gained with their iPhone, offering only one price range of phone means that consumers can only choose the premium model at any time (sans storage options). This strategy has shown to be extremely lucrative with Apple, however Sony has already been manufacturing "premium" smartphones for several years now. It really doesn't make too much sense that simply eliminating your more consumer-friendly models would change your economics.

Who knows, maybe Sony will be the next Apple!
